Low-SWaP High-performance Eye-safe LiDAR utilizing Static Unitary Detector Technique

Not Accessible

Your library or personal account may give you access

Abstract

We implemented wide field-of-view and high-resolution LiDAR operated under the low-SWaP condition using a developed optical receiver based on the static unitary detector technique and showed detailed results concerning the photodetector and LiDAR performance.
